Discover Ludwig"land improvements" is a correct and usable phrase in written English.
You can use it to refer to any changes or additions made to land to improve its value or make it more user-friendly, either for agricultural purposes or for commercial or residential development. For example, you could say, "The developers made several land improvements, including a walking trail and a garden, to make the area more desirable."
